LBMS art students show support of Ukraine with heartfelt expressions messages

Students in Front of

Long Beach Middle School seventh grade art students participated in a collaborative online art slideshow entitled “heARTfelt Expressions” expressing care for the people of Ukraine hosted by Online Art Teachers (K-12).

The slideshow of over 100 entries contains the visual voices of more than 1500 global school children and art teachers from four continents. LBMS art teacher Laura Swan said, “We were honored to demonstrate student agency through art and to represent our school and the USA together with art slides from four continents and over 1500 submissions!”

Additionally, the young Long Beach artists created a bulletin board in conjunction with the theme of the online art project.

Online Art Teachers (K-12) is a group that was established in March 2020 to help art teachers with the challenging, sudden, and swift pivot to remote and hybrid instruction due to the COVID-19 pandemic.
